THE DETROIT JEWISH -NEWS

Harry Schumer. Memorial Dec. 22

Friday, Dec. 13, 1974-21

Communal recognition for
the late Harry Schumer's
many services to Israel, the
Jewish community and the
labor Zionist movement will
be rendered at a special
memorial meeting, 11 a.m.
. 22 in Laikin Auditorium
Dec.
of the Labor Zionist 'Institute.

Mr. Schuiner, who died
Nov. 14 at age 78, was a
founder of the Arlazaroff
Branch of the "Arbeiter Far-
band" which raised funds for
Palestine in the 1930s and en-
listed support, among, the
young U.S. labor unions for
-the future state of Israel.
His friends at LZA recall
his many activities in behalf
of - Histadrut, Ampal, the
Workers Bank, the Jewish
Teachers Seminary, the Far-

In Detroit, he devoted him-
self wholeheartedly to the
work for Israel.
In 1950 Schumer came for
another visit. He was enthus-
iastically received by Hista-
drut and government leaders
—many his old friends now
at the helm of the state.
In recognition of their
fundraising work, the Hista-
drut Executive voted 14
years ago to name the cul-
tural center in Kibutz Hanita
after him and his .Poalei Zion
Club here.
The Jewish National Fund
dedicated a "Schumer Wood"
and Histadrut built a youth
center in Acco, Israel, in his
honor.
